Box Score HOBOKEN, NJ - The second-seeded College at Florham Devils outlasted top-seeded Stevens, 2-1, in eleven innings to win the 2012 ECAC Metro Region Championship on Sunday afternoon. Senior pitcher
Mike Winters was named Tournament MVP after tossing three shutout innings to pick up the win in relief.
With the win, the Devils finished the season with a record of 24-18.
The Devils got on the board first with a run in the top of the first inning on a solo home run by senior outfielder
Matt Joiner. The Ducks came right back to tie it at 1-1 in the bottom half of the fourth and the game remained tied all the way up until the top of the twelfth inning. Senior first baseman
Ryan Fandel ripped a double with one out in the inning and advance to third on a groundout. After a walk to senior catcher
Nick Marcucci, freshman outfielder
Frankie Tassielli came through with a RBI single to score Fandel in what turned out to be the game-winning run. In the bottom of the 12th, Winters walked the leadoff batter but induced a ground ball double play with one out to end the game.
Marcucci, senior third baseman
John Pieper and sophomore second baseman
Brandan Adams all had two hits for FDU in the win. Sophomore pitcher
Chris Roberts started the game and was fantastic on the hill, tossing eight innings while allowing just one run on five hits to go along with eight strikeouts.
